A. 24- Band Concert at LaGrange 25- Band Concert at Grafton 29-Athletic Banquet 2-Back to School 7-At Columbia, Basketball Game 11-Grafton-Avon, Basketball Game 17,18-Exams 18-At Rldgevllle, Basketball Game 18-Semester Ends 22-Grafton-South Amherst, Basketball Game 25-At Brookslde, Basketball Game May 2-Assembly 10-Junior-Senior Prom «•. 16-Senlor Exams 18-Baccalaureate 20-Commencement 20,21-Exams 22-Spring Round-up 24-Class Day OUR P R O M ' ’ We presented our ‘Prom' to the Senior Class of ’51 on May 19, 1951. The theme was ‘Hawaiian Paradise’. On walking into the gym one found a bridge of green and white, spanning imitation water. It was decorated with blossoms from May Apples and Confetti. Miles of red, yellow, green, and other brightly colored crepe paper covered the gym in an octagonal shape. Around the floor were placed palms, and a palm tree stood at the entrance to the stage. Here some of our pictures were taken. The punch bar was located in a small, decorated room on the stage. The junior mothers served a wonderful turkey dinner on small card tables, decorated with small individual palm trees and place cards and memory books with a Hawaiian scene pictured on them. In the center of the tables were vases with crochetted carnations of pink and white in them. After the dinner, music for dancing was furnished by Rocco Trombetto’s Orchestra. As we danced that night, we looked around at all our guests enjoying themselves, and knew that all our work and planning was not in vain. Now as we look back upon our prom, we know that it will always hold a cherished place in our memories.
